The Tyneside Irish Brigade was a British First World War infantry brigade of Kitchener's Army, raised in 1914. Officially numbered the 103rd Brigade, it contained four Pals battalions from Newcastle upon Tyne, largely made up of men of Irish extraction..

Jacques Cazotte was a French author and a monarchist. He predicted the Reign of Terror and was guillotined shortly after.

Cool Nights is a 1991 studio album by American jazz vibraphonist Gary Burton. Burton is featured with tenor saxophonist Bob Berg, guitarist Wolfgang Muthspiel, bassist Will Lee and drummer Peter Erskine.
